흡수에 의한 시설/용량별 설계예

아질산염소조->WET SCRUBBER 500 CMM

배출가스량 산정 

    (1) 배출시설 규격
        1) 아질산염소조 : W3M x L2M x H2.4M x 3SET

    (2) 배출가스량 산정

        1) PULL 가스량 산정
           QO = 75cfm/sq ft of tank Surfce area
                = 75 x 3 x 2 x 0.3048
                = 137.16 x 3SET
                = 411.48CMM x 1.2(여유율)
                ≒ 500 M3/MIN

        2) PUSH 풍량 산정
                                             +-----
           QS = QJ x L , QJ = 243 -+  AJ

              ㅇ. PUSH NOZZLE SIZE :  5MM
              ㅇ. PUSH NOZZLE PITOH : PITCH : 25M/M
                                                   PUSH 배관길이           2
              ㅇ. PUSH NOZZLE 수량 : ---------------- =  -------  = 80EA
                                                   NOZZLE PITCH        0.025

                        3.14 x 0.05^2
            ※ AJ = ------------- x 80EA = 0.157 MM2
                                4

                             +--------
               QJ = 243 -+  0.157       =   96.3 cfm/ft

                                                 3
               QS = 117.9 cmf/ft x (---------)ft
                                             0.3048

                   = 948cfm x 0.0283 

                  ≒ 30m3/min x 3set = 90M3/MIN

            ※ PULL HOOD 산정

               H = 0.14W

                  = 0.14 x 1.5

                  = 0.21M (H:OPEN HEIGHT)

            ※ OUT DIMENSION
                         :  WIDTH    = 600
                         :  HEIGHT  = 600
                         :  LENGTH = 2600 

방지시설 설계 사양 

   - 설계사양
       ㅇ. 방지 시설명 : 세정식 집진시설 (WET SCRUBBER)
       ㅇ. 연계배출시설명 : 아질산염조 3SET
       ㅇ. 공탑속도 : 1.5M/SEC
       ㅇ. 액가스비 : 2L/M3
       ㅇ. 닥트유입속도 : 15M/SEC
       ㅇ. 배출풍량 : 500M3/MIN

      1) BODY SIZE (D) 산정
                +-------------
        D =   |       4 x Q
               | -------------
             -+  3.14 x V x 60

               +--------------
          =   |      4 x 500
              | --------------
            -+  3.14 x 1.5 x 60

          =   2.7M

      2) 탑높이(H) 산정
         ㅇ. 세정수 TANK : 1.2M
         ㅇ. 배출가스량 유입부 : 1.5M
         ㅇ. 충진층 : 1M (500M x 2단)
         ㅇ. 살수층 : 500M/M x 2단
         ㅇ. 노즐층 : 300MM x 2단
         ㅇ. 기액분리층 : 500MM
         ㅇ. 충탑고 : 5.8M

      3) 본체규격 :  2,7M x 5.8mH
         ㅇ. 본체재질 : F.R.P 13PLY
         ㅇ. PALLING : PE (2")
         ㅇ. NOZZLE : P.V.C
         ㅇ. DEMISTER : P.P

      4) DUCT 규격 산정

         ㅇ. 닥트규격 (D)
                     +--------------
                    |      4 x 500
            D =   | --------------
                 -+   3.14 x 15 x 60

               = 840

         ㅇ. 닥트재질 : F.R.P 8PLY

      5) HOOD 규격 산정

         ㅇ. HOOD 규격

            1) PUSH 규격 : W150 x L2,000 x 3SET

            2) PULL 규격 : W2,600 x H600(210) x 3SET

         ㅇ. 재질 : F.R.P  8PLY

      6) CIRCULATION PUMP
         ㅇ. PUMP VOLUME : 500M3/MIN x 2L/M3 = 1,000L/MIN
              PUMP 사양 : 100A x 1.0M3/MIN x 18mH x 2SET (F.R.P)
         ㅇ. MOTOR : 10HP x 2ST

6. FAN 사양

   가. PULL FAN
      ㅇ. 형 식 : TURBO - FAN
      ㅇ. 풍 량 : 500M3/MIN
      ㅇ. 풍 압 : 250mmAq
                                 Q x △P
      ㅇ. 동 력 (HP) = ------------- x 1.2
                              4,500 x 0.65

                                500 x 250
                          = ------------- x 1.2
                              4,500 x 0.65

                          = 50HP
      ㅇ. 재 질 ; F.R.P

   나. PUSH FAN
      ㅇ. 형 식 : TURBO - BLOWER
      ㅇ. 풍 량 : 90CMM
      ㅇ. 풍 압 : 150mmAq
                                Q x △P
      ㅇ. 동 력 (HP) = ------------- x 1.2
                              4,500 x 0.65

                                90 x 150
                          = ------------- x 1.2
                              4,500 x 0.65

                          = 7.5 HP
      ㅇ. 재 질 ; SS - 41 (F.R.P 라이닝)
